
Plenty of ADCI Awards for IED graduands
IED proves itself once again as the best Italian creative school, in the ninth edition of IF! Italian Festival, when the ADCI Awards 2022 were presented. The recent graduates of IED Milano won a gold, a silver, four mentions and a special mention in the student category. The jury, chaired by Bruno Bertelli (Global CCO Publicis Worldwide and CCO of Publicis Groupe Italia) awarded the first prize to the Undelivered Love campaign created for the US Postal Service by Anita Borsari and Elisa Zanchin, alumnae of the Master in Creative Direction. The idea behind the project is to dedicate a moment of Pride 2023 to the symbolic sending of all the letters ever delivered in the United States in 1973, when the American Congress approved an act which forbade the sending by post of obscene material including even gay love letters. The target? Launch a strong and poetic message against all forms of oppression.
The alumni of the Triennial course in Communication Design, Alessandro Azzolini (Copywriter), Giorgia Cavadini, Francesco Cogliati and Edoardo Dusina (Art director) conquered the second step of the podium with the campaign The Loft for Bang&Olufsen. The project is a social experiment that aims to bring together different generations with different musical tastes through a playlist created by 10 very heterogeneous artist couples. The songs will then be played on digital media such as Amazon Prime, as well as vintage media, such as vinyl records.
